Styliani Tsikouna
Appearance
Styliani ("Stella") Tsikouna (Greek: Στυλιανή "Στέλλα" Τσικούνα also written Stiliani Tsikouna, born October 19, 1972 in Chalcis) is a Greek discus thrower.
Her personal best throw is 65.25 metres, achieved in May 2004 in Iraklio. This ranks her third among Greek discus throwers, only behind Ekaterini Voggoli and Anastasia Kelesidou. [1]
Achievements
Year | Competition | Venue | Position | Notes |
---|---|---|---|---|
Representing Greece | ||||
1996 | Olympic Games | Atlanta, United States | 31st | 56.66 m |
1997 | World Championships | Athens, Greece | 7th | 61.92 m |
Mediterranean Games | Bari, Italy | 2nd | 61.96 m | |
1998 | European Championships | Budapest, Hungary | 12th | |
1999 | World Championships | Seville, Spain | 8th | |
2000 | Olympic Games | Sydney, Australia | 5th | 64.08 m |
2001 | World Championships | Edmonton, Canada | 18th | 60.32 m |
2004 | Olympic Games | Athens, Greece | 11th | 59.48 m |
